August 8, 201213 yr Killing them doesn't really help you since they just pop up and down really often. Just use gano + range protect and stay away from the mage tentacles. Save magic crystals and constitution crystals for the final wave to help you survive longer. Just don't EVER go towards the middle/center of the arena or you will take more damage than necessary.
August 8, 201213 yr Hug a corner where there's no more than 2 that you can't pray against. If you want you can try to kill the tentacles that are damaging you but leave the ones you're praying against (as a harmful one could spawn in its place) Gano/range protect worked for me but be smart about it, check the types of tentacles on you, and swtich to magic if that's all there is. Obviously an elysian would help (slightly). Also, don't stand in melee distance of tentacles.
August 8, 201213 yr Your main issues is that you don't have Soul Split or a Unicorn; both of which can greatly increase the amount of healing power you have once you reach the final wave.
August 8, 201213 yr In summary from the above two post, and my own experience:- Are you using Gano, protect from Range and a magic crystal when you reach Hakaan?- Are you staying out of melee zone?- Are you using SoA to speed up the kill?- Flashing soulsplit and a unicorn are both extremely useful for the boss.- An Ely isn't all that useful.
